Answer:


\mathrm{The\ given\ figure\ is\ relabeled\ as\ follows:}\\\mathrm{From\ the\ figure,}\\\mathrm{OA=OB\ \ \ [Radii\ of\ same\ circle\ is\ equal.]}\\\mathrm{\angle OAB=\angle OAC=}a^o\ \ \ [\mathrm{OA=OB,\ base\ angles\ of\ isosceles\ triangle\ OAB.}]\\


\mathrm{Now},\\\ \mathrm{\angle OAB+\angle OBA+70^o=180^o\ \ \ [Sum\ of\ interior\ angles\ of\ triangle\ is\ 180^o.]}\\\mathrm{or,\ }a^o+a^o+70^o=180^o\\\mathrm{or,\ }2a^o=110^o\\\mathrm{or,\ }a^o=55^o


\mathrm{Finally,}\\\mathrm{\angle BCA=(1)/(2)\angle BOA\ \ \ [Inscribed\ angle\ is\ half\ of\ the\ central\ angle\ on \same\ arc.]}\\\\\mathrm{or,\ }b^o=(1)/(2)* 70^o\\\\\mathrm{or,\ }b^o=35^o
